Romanian CEC Depositors To Receive Compensations As Of Oct 30Updated: 25-09-2008 |
Romanians who deposited money in savings bank CEC to buy Dacia cars will receive compensations starting October 30, two months earlier than planned.
The value of compensations amounts to 760 million lei (EUR1=RON3.6596).
"Today (Wednesday, e.n.) we shall propose a government ordinance to allow earlier payments starting October 30," economy and finance minister Varujan Vosganian told a press conference Wednesday.
Moreover, the number of beneficiaries rose to 37,478 people.
The government said Tuesday that the people who deposited money in CEC to buy cars would receive compensations two months earlier than planned after it decided in March this year that payments would be made starting Dec 22, 2008.
The treasury bills granted as compensations are issued on Dec 21, 2007 and mature on Dec 21, 2008.
Finance minister Varujan Vosganian said end February that people who deposited money in CEC before 1992 to buy Dacia cars would receive their money back in one installment, starting Dec 22, 2008.
